The current 30-yr mortgage rate (6.8%) exceeds the estimated cap rate (6.0%). Financing reduces your cash-on-cash return below the cap rate. Markets like this may still make sense as IRR plays — factoring in appreciation, depreciation, and a future refinance when rates drop.

About Repit School Scores
Traditional school ratings rely heavily on standardized test scores, which often reflect family income more than school quality. Repit takes a different approach.
We evaluate schools based on factors that research shows actually impact educational outcomes:
- Class Size — Smaller classes mean more individual attention
- School Funding — Resources available for programs, staff, and facilities
- Community Factors — Neighborhood characteristics that influence student success
- School Environment — Size, type, and structure
Scores are updated annually using federal education data.
